How Buyers Usually Build This Set

Most buyers start with one hero item, then add smaller supporting pieces around it. For example, a notebook or tumbler can anchor the set, while a pen, keychain, mug, or lanyard rounds it out. If the set is meant for employee welcome use, brands often prefer cleaner colors and more practical desk items. If it is for an event or booth handout, lighter and faster-to-distribute items usually make more sense.

This approach helps you shape the set around the moment. A conference kit feels different from a partner gift. A school campaign pack feels different from a sales meeting set. The flexibility of the format is what makes it so useful across many industries.

Where and How It's Made?

Primary canvas weaving and raw cotton fiber extraction processes are situated within the established textile industrial ecosystems of Ningbo and Shaoxing, Zhejiang Province. This regional supply core yields uniform 340 GSM organic canvas rolls that pass automated optical density checks before mechanical cutting. Raw fabric lots are stabilized for moisture control before delivery to print stations to prevent post-production panel warp.

Secondary material integration—encompassing high-density 1200 GSM structural grayboard and 400 GSM SBS cardstock wrappers—is sourced from packaging material specialized zones in Cangnan. The structural paper components are scored on automated CNC matrix tables to guarantee tight folding tolerances when paired with nylon slider tracks and cast zinc hardware attachments sourced from local component distributors.

Materials, Construction & Specifications
MATERIAL PRIMARY: 340 GSM Organic Cotton Canvas (Accessories), 1200 GSM Heavy Solid Grayboard (Gift Box Core).
STANDARD DIMENSIONS: Main Gift Box Enclosure: 34cm x 25cm x 8.5cm; Zippered Canvas Pouch: 22cm x 15cm; Custom Insert Cards: 14.8cm x 10.5cm.
WEIGHT PER UNIT: 0.68 kg average combined mass per fully bundled corporate gift set.
SURFACE TREATMENT: Automated screen-print ink application, high-speed fiber laser marking, mechanical cardstock matte coating.

Packaging, Carton & Shipping Details
ORIGIN & FACTORY TYPE: China Factory Direct Custom Manufacturing Facility
INNER PACKAGING: Individual 0.05mm moisture-impermeable LDPE bags flat-packed with silica gel packets, enclosed in fitted paperboard gift sleeves.
MASTER CARTON: 5-layer double-wall BC-flute export corrugated boxes, ECT-44 structural rating, 15 complete welcome packs per master carton, max gross weight 16.2 kg.
PALLET SPEC: Standard 1200x1000mm fumigated heat-treated export pallets, stacked 4 tiers high with vertical corner guard strips, wrapped in 5 layers of 25-micron stretch film.
REQUIRED DOCUMENTATION: Commercial Invoice, Itemized Packing List, Certificate of Origin, Lot Quality Inspection Logs, TSCA Title VI Paper Compliance Declaration.
